DescriptionA man sits on a chair inside a sitting room or parlor looking at a newspaper which holds in both hands. He is wearing a shirt and necktie and has a pipe in his mouth. Throw pillows and a book are on a sofa or daybed at the right. One of the pillows says "Lake Placid" on it. A large lamp with a fringed lampshade is on a table at the left. Framed pictures and patterned wallpaper are on the walls.
